The EU Tyre Label provides standardized information about fuel efficiency, wet grip, and external rolling noise of tyres.
- Fuel efficiency – rated A (best) to E (worst). Better rated tyres reduce fuel consumption and CO₂ emissions.
- Wet grip – rated A (best) to E (worst). Better wet grip means shorter braking distance on wet roads.
- Noise level – external rolling noise in decibels (dB). Class A is quietest, C is loudest.
Based on EU Regulation 2020/740, effective from May 2021. View full details on EPREL →
